在日常办公或开发中,我们常常需要将网页(HTML)内容保存为 Word 文档格式(如 .doc 或 .docx),以便进行打印、分享或进一步编辑。本文将介绍几种简单有效的 HTML 转 Word 方法。
一、使用浏览器直接另存为
这是最简单的方法,适用于内容结构不复杂的 HTML 页面:
- 打开目标 HTML 页面;
- 点击浏览器菜单中的“文件” → “另存为”;
- 选择保存类型为“网页,全部 (*.htm;*.html)”或“单个文件 (*.mht)”,然后手动复制内容到 Word 中;
- 或者直接在 Word 中使用“插入” → “对象” → “文件中的文字”导入 HTML 文件。
二、使用在线转换工具
对于希望保留格式且操作更便捷的用户,推荐使用专业在线工具:
- 上传 HTML 文件或粘贴 HTML 代码;
- 工具自动解析并转换为可下载的 Word 文档;
- 适合批量处理或复杂样式保留。
三、通过编程方式转换(开发者适用)
如果你是开发者,可以使用以下技术方案:
- JavaScript + Blob:动态生成包含 HTML 内容的 .doc 文件(兼容性有限);
- Python(python-docx / WeasyPrint):服务端渲染 HTML 并输出为 Word;
- Node.js(html-docx-js):将 HTML 字符串转换为 .docx 格式。
四、注意事项
- 复杂的 CSS 样式可能无法完全在 Word 中还原;
- 建议使用语义化 HTML 标签(如 <p>、<h1>、<table>)以提高兼容性;
- 图片、表格等元素需确保路径正确或内联嵌入。